Good morning! We have a ProLiant DL180 G5 server running Windows 2008 Server Standard (32-bit). Device Manager lists two "other devices": SM Bus Controller and an Unknown Device.
The "unknown device" has a hardware id of "ACPI\HPI0002".
The "SM Bus Controller" has a hardware id of "PCI\VEN_8086&DEV_2930&SUBSYS_31F4103C&REV_02".
I found out (through PCIDatabase.com) that the SM Bus Controller is an Intel ICH9 Family SMBus Controller. Our server has Intel Xeon E5405 chipsets.
I have not been able to find the proper driver for the controller, either on HP's site or on Intel's. I downloaded the Chipset Identification Utility, but it could not identify the chipset on our server.
What drivers do we need to install so these "other devices" will work properly?

Hi,
Install Null Management INF drivers from link below to resolve this issue:
HP ProLiant 100 Series Servers Null Management INF Installer Smart Component for Microsoft Windows Server 2003/2008:

SolutionI am glad to know that the issue resolved,
To resolve "SM Bus Controller" issue, Install chipset driver to resolve this issue.
You can find these drivers in Support CD that is shipped along with the server.
Refer HP ProLiant DL180 Generation 5 Server Software Configuration Guide:
http://bizsupport1.austin.hp.com/bc/docs/support/SupportManual/c01311211/c01311211.pdf
Refer Page number 28 тАЬSection 3. Completing the installation - Phase 1 - Installing the chipset driverтАЭ also install network and video drivers.
If the above did not resolve the issue try installing Intel INF update utility
If the issue not resolved, right click on the SM Bus Controller and click properties and upload the screenshot.
